I have been reading reviews and comparisons on various 360 rads. The black Ice seems to lag behind on all settings except for max fan speeds, 2000 RPM+. I decided against using it because I don't want such noise.
on the reviews you were looking at were you looking at the GTX or the SR1 because the gtx is made for high speed fans
GTX, sorry should've specified
oh see the gtx has 20 FPI while the SR1 has only 9 meaning, gtx needs high air flow but in the end will cool alot more, but sr1 line needs lower airflow to reach its peak efficentcy. id rather shove 2 big rads in here and have it silent then have 1 smaller one and have leaf blowers attacted to it.
